The Flight of the Butterfly

In his most recent letter, economist Peter Linneman presents a compelling case for an erratic recovery for at least the next 6 months. As the distribution of the vaccine is met with headwinds and the time lag between effective distribution and dissipation of the fear factor, congregating in any substantive way seems all too distant. He anticipates the recovery will follow the random flight path of a butterfly, rather than the true trajectory of a migratory bird. The perfect storm of botched distribution and a new more virulent strain of Covid that is many times more contagious does not bode well for a speedy recovery in 2021. The mathematics of exponential increase in contagiousness from the new strain could portend frightening consequences when we are even on the verge of containing the pandemic.

In the meantime, he explains, this is the ideal time to take stock of what 2021 is bringing. In the January 6th Walker Webcast, he shares his thoughts on bigger office space, the future of multifamily, how assets are changing and more.
